#dd8ffe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dd8ffe is composed of 86.7% red, 56.1%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13% cyan, 43.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 282.2 degrees, a saturation of 98.2% and a lightness of 77.8%. #dd8ffe color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bb1ffd. Closest websafe color is: #cc99ff.

Shades and Tints of #dd8ffe

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030005 is the darkest color, while #fbf0ff is the lightest one.
